Portuguese Private School Rejects Cristiano Ronaldo's Children Due to Concerns of Overexposure

On October 2, according to a report by the Look portal, Cristiano Ronaldo and Georgina Rodríguez had applied for their five children to enter St. Julian’s College, one of the most prestigious schools in Portugal, but their children were not accepted.

It is known that Cristiano Ronaldo and Georgina had visited the facilities of this private school. However, the reason for the rejection of their application by the educational center remains unknown, though it appears to be related to the parents’ celebrity status.

According to the Portuguese TV program V+FAMA, “Cristiano Ronaldo’s children did not get into St. Julian’s School, partly because some parent representatives at the center put up obstacles.”

“Based on the information we have, many of these parent representatives are also very influential, and they asked the educational center whether they could guarantee the safety and privacy of the children, as the admission of the two celebrities’ children might result in newspaper reporters crowding the school gates every day,” they added.
